Aubrey de Grey improved the lower bound for the chromatic number of the plane to 5 in 2018 using a graph that has >1000 nodes.
"The chromatic number of the plane is at least 5" Aubrey D. N. J. de Grey, 2018 (https://doi.org/10.48550/arXiv.1804.02385)
